HI Guys
can someone please show a picture where i can fine heater core hoses in and out.
i am looking to flush heater core on 2004 maxima.
whats the procedure to flush heater core.

If you look under the air filter intake tube you'll see two rubber hoses going to the firewall. Remove both of them on the engine side. Use a garden hose to flush not air. With your water on low put the hose on either side of the heater core and watch what comes out. Hopefully you will see some brown ish colored crud coming out. Flush both sides till the water is clear. Put it back together and begin filling the radiator. Probably have to burp the system several times and your done.
